| Graceworks Ministries assists those in need in Williamson County with services ranging from helping to provide the basic necessities of life for families to helping our senior clients with rides to their medical appointments. | |||
Emergency
Services One-on-one counseling for needs assessment and crisis identification Help with rent, utilities, gas vouchers, car repair help, school supplies, financial guidance Referrals and resource lists of other organizations and facilities that can help Patricia Brinkmann Education Fund Disaster relief partner with Red Cross |
Food
Pantry Food provided by private and community donations Dietary supplements as well as baby food and formula Personal hygiene items, cleaning supplies and paper goods not available through food stamps |
||
Senior
Services Transportation to medical appointments Small home repairs and help Electronic in-home monitors |
Health
Services Durable medical equipment Dietary supplements like Ensure |
||
Christmas
Programs The Manger - opportunity for parents to select gifts for their children from thousands of donated gifts and have them gift wrapped for free We share the Gospel in the Good News Room with all participants in The Manger. Over 1000 volunteers help at the Manger, from collecting gifts to helping families "shop." We helped 541 families in 2009, and collected more than 10,000 gifts for The Manger. Qualified families may receive a food basket, delivered to their home by volunteer sponsors. Our volunteers provided nearly 800 food boxes for families in need. |
